THE Football Association has this lunchtime announced the league allocations for the 2026/27 season. Steeton will remain in the North West Counties First Division North for a ninth consecutive season. Steeton AFC are today delighted to announce the arrival of Matt Barnes as the club’s new Assistant Manager. Replacing Jacob Mistry, who departed Marley earlier this week to fill the managerial vacancy at Ilkley Town, Barnes brings a wealth of experience to the role. STEETON have today received a new date for our forthcoming First Division North fixture away at Maghull. With both teams now having a free weekend, the match at the DT Hughes Community Stadium, originally scheduled for Saturday 13th December, has been brought forward to Saturday 18th October. THE West Riding County FA have today announced the First Round draw for the 2025/26 Senior County Cup. The Senior County Cup, won last season by Route One Rovers, pits the 29 professional and semi-professional clubs within the Non-League system in the county against each other.
